Reticulocytes in haematological disorders

G d'Onofrio1, R Kuse, C Foures

  • 1Universita Cattolica, Roma, Italy.

Clinical and Laboratory Haematology
|December 1, 1996
PubMed
Summary

Flow cytometry precisely measures reticulocyte counts and highly fluorescent macroreticulocytes (HFR). This aids in diagnosing hematological disorders by reflecting bone marrow erythrocyte production and erythropoietic stimulation intensity.

Area of Science:

  • Hematology
  • Clinical Chemistry
  • Flow Cytometry

Background:

  • Flow cytometry offers enhanced precision for reticulocyte count analysis.
  • Measurement of reticulocyte RNA content identifies highly fluorescent macroreticulocytes (HFR), indicating premature release from bone marrow.
  • HFR signifies increased erythropoietic stimulation.

Purpose of the Study:

  • To define reference values for absolute reticulocyte number and HFR percentage in untreated hematological disorders.
  • To utilize Sysmex R-1000 or R-3000 flow cytometers for this analysis.

Main Methods:

  • Analysis of 54 healthy subjects and 100 untreated patients with five hematological diseases.
  • Flow cytometric measurement of reticulocyte count and HFR percentage.

Main Results:

  • Haemolytic anaemias: Increased reticulocyte count and HFR; inverse correlation between reticulocyte count and Hb.
  • Polycythaemia vera: Moderately increased reticulocytes; direct correlation with Hb.
  • Dyserythropoietic syndromes: Low reticulocytes, moderately increased HFR; inverse correlation between HFR and Hb.
  • Acute myeloid leukaemia: Low reticulocytes, increased HFR; correlation between reticulocytes, HFR, and Hb.
  • Acute lymphoid leukaemia: Normal reticulocyte count, increased HFR.

Conclusions:

  • Established reference values for reticulocyte counts and HFR in hematological diseases.
  • Reticulocyte count reflects effective bone marrow erythrocyte production in anemia.
  • HFR proportion indicates the intensity of erythropoietic stimulation.
